Originally a Texan, Nicole can usually be found wandering about Brooklyn with her headphones on or trying to practice her banjo while concocting things edible or crafty in her Flatbush apartment. After moving to the Big Apple, she worked for several publications including Seventeen, Teen People, Cutting Edge, and Adorn. Her work has also been featured in several publications including Adorn, Knit.1, BUST and several other books and magazines.

Nicole currently designs clothing, jewelry, accessories and sewing patterns, in between working as the Associate Editor for Threads and SewStylish magazines.
